Understanding SEO: The Basics
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is the process of improving your website to increase its visibility when people search for products or services related to your business in search engines like Google. Think of it as making your website more attractive to search engines so they'll show it to more people. The higher your website ranks in search results, the more likely people are to see it and visit your site.
Why is SEO important, you ask? Well, in today's digital age, most people turn to search engines when they're looking for something. If your website isn't showing up in those search results, you're missing out on potential customers. Good SEO helps you get found by the right people at the right time.
There are two main types of SEO: on-page and off-page. On-page SEO refers to everything you can do on your website to improve its ranking. This includes optimizing your website's content, using relevant keywords, having a clear site structure, and ensuring your website is mobile-friendly. Off-page SEO, on the other hand, involves actions taken outside of your website to impact your rankings. This includes building backlinks from other reputable websites, social media marketing, and online reputation management.
Keywords are a crucial part of SEO. These are the words and phrases that people use when searching for something online. To effectively optimize your website, you need to identify the keywords that your target audience is using and incorporate them into your website's content, meta descriptions, and title tags. For example, if you own a pizza restaurant in Cucamonga, you might want to target keywords like "pizza Cucamonga," "best pizza in Cucamonga," or "pizza delivery Cucamonga."
SEO is not a one-time task; it's an ongoing process. Search engine algorithms are constantly evolving, so you need to stay up-to-date with the latest SEO trends and best practices. Regularly update your website's content, monitor your rankings, and adjust your SEO strategy as needed. With consistent effort, you can improve your website's visibility and attract more organic traffic.
The Power of Local Search
Local search is a specific type of search that focuses on finding businesses and services within a particular geographic area. When someone searches for "coffee shops near me" or "plumbers in Cucamonga," they're using local search. Local search results are often displayed in a special section of the search engine results page, such as the Google Maps listing or the local pack.
For businesses in Cucamonga, local search is incredibly important. It allows you to connect with customers who are actively looking for your products or services in your area. By optimizing your online presence for local search, you can increase your visibility in local search results and drive more foot traffic to your business.
One of the key elements of local search is Google My Business (GMB). This is a free business listing that allows you to provide information about your business, such as your address, phone number, website, business hours, and customer reviews. Claiming and optimizing your GMB listing is essential for local SEO. Make sure your GMB listing is complete, accurate, and up-to-date. Add photos and videos to showcase your business, and encourage your customers to leave reviews. Positive reviews can significantly improve your visibility and attract more customers.
Another important factor in local search is local citations. These are mentions of your business name, address, and phone number (NAP) on other websites, such as online directories, review sites, and local business listings. Consistent and accurate NAP information across all your citations is crucial. Look for opportunities to list your business on relevant local directories and industry-specific websites.
Local SEO also involves optimizing your website for local keywords. Use location-specific keywords throughout your website's content, meta descriptions, and title tags. For example, if you own a hair salon in Cucamonga, you might want to target keywords like "hair salon Cucamonga," "best hair salon in Cucamonga," or "haircuts Cucamonga." In addition to optimizing your website, consider creating local content, such as blog posts or articles about events, attractions, or news in Cucamonga.

Measuring Your SEO Success
It's important to track your SEO progress and measure your results. This will help you understand what's working and what's not, so you can adjust your strategy accordingly. There are several tools you can use to track your SEO performance, such as Google Analytics and Google Search Console.
Google Analytics provides valuable insights into your website's traffic, including the number of visitors, the sources of traffic, the pages they visit, and the time they spend on your website. Use Google Analytics to track your organic traffic, monitor your bounce rate, and identify your most popular pages.
Google Search Console provides data about your website's performance in Google search results. You can use Google Search Console to track your keyword rankings, identify crawl errors, and submit your sitemap to Google. Google Search Console also provides alerts about potential issues that could affect your website's search rankings.
Monitor your keyword rankings regularly to see how your website is performing for your target keywords. Use a keyword tracking tool to track your rankings over time. If you're not ranking well for certain keywords, consider adjusting your SEO strategy and optimizing your website's content for those keywords.
Track your website's traffic from local search. See how many visitors are finding your website through local search results. Monitor your GMB listing's performance, including the number of views, clicks, and calls. This will help you understand the impact of your local SEO efforts.
Finally, track your conversion rates. How many of your website visitors are turning into customers? Are people who find your website through local search more likely to convert? By tracking your conversion rates, you can measure the ROI of your SEO efforts and identify areas for improvement.
Staying Ahead of the Curve
SEO is a constantly evolving field, so it's important to stay up-to-date with the latest trends and best practices. Follow industry blogs, attend SEO conferences, and network with other SEO professionals. By staying informed, you can ensure that your SEO strategy remains effective and competitive.
Mobile-first indexing is a major trend to watch. Google is now primarily using the mobile version of websites for indexing and ranking. Make sure your website is fully optimized for mobile devices. This means having a responsive design, fast loading speeds, and a user-friendly mobile experience.
Voice search is also becoming increasingly popular. As more and more people use voice assistants like Siri and Alexa, it's important to optimize your website for voice search. This means using natural language, answering common questions, and optimizing for long-tail keywords.
Artificial intelligence (AI) is playing an increasingly important role in SEO. Google is using AI to better understand search queries and deliver more relevant search results. Stay up-to-date with the latest AI developments and how they could impact your SEO strategy.
By continuously learning and adapting, you can stay ahead of the curve and maintain a competitive edge in the ever-changing world of SEO.
